π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

11 items
  • 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 0.75 cups all-purpose flour
  • 0.75 cups yellow cornmeal
  • 0.33 cups gran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2.5 cups whole milk
  • 1 cups heavy cream
  • 1.5 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oons white vinegar

πŸ“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350Β°F (175Β°C). Lightly grease a 9-inch round or square baking dish with butter or non-stick spray and set aside.

2

Melt the 4 tablespoons of unsalted butter in a microwave or on the stovetop and let it cool slightly.

3

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, yellow cornmeal,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t until evenly combined.

4

In another bowl, whisk the eggs, 1 cup of the whole milk, and the white vinegar. Add the melted butter and vanilla extract, whisking until smooth.

5

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until just combined. The batter will be slightly lumpy; do not overmix.

6

Transfer the batter to your prepared baking dish, spreading it into an even layer.

7

Carefully pour the remaining whole milk (1.5 cups) and the heavy cream over the batter. Pour slowly and evenlyβ€”it will appear to sit on top but will bake into the batter, creating the custard center.

8

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the custard layer is set but still slightly jiggly in the middle.

9

Remove the cornbread from the oven and let it cool for at least 15 minutes to allow the custard to fully set. Serve warm or at room temperature.
